California Corporations Code

§ 12453

CORP § 12453Div. 3 · Title 1 · Part 2 · Ch. 4 · Art. 1
Neither a corporation nor any of its subsidiaries shall purchase or redeem memberships, or make a patronage distribution to members out of earnings of the corporation on nonmember patronage, or make a distribution, if the corporation or the subsidiary purchasing or redeeming memberships or making the distribution is, or as a result thereof would be, likely to be unable to meet its liabilities (except those whose payment is otherwise adequately provided for) as they mature.

Legislative history

Repealed and added by Stats. 1982, Ch. 1625, Sec. 3. Operative January 1, 1984.
